Usage Note
Iniciativa carries the same range as English 'initiative': a business initiative, a legislative initiative, or the quality of acting without being told. The phrase tomar la iniciativa (to take the initiative) is a common fixed expression.
Examples
"Tomaron la iniciativa desde el principio."
Natural Translation
They took the initiative from the start.
Literal Translation
They-took the initiative from the beginning
